WebNov 1, 2024 · The Java String Pool is a data structure that exists in the heap, that is used in order to optimize the memory space strings use. ... In any case, we get a reference to … WebNov 6, 2024 · Video. String Interning is a method of storing only one copy of each distinct String Value, which must be immutable. By applying String.intern () on a couple of strings will ensure that all strings having …
What is String Pool in Java String Pool Examples Edureka
In computer science, string interning is a method of storing only one copy of each distinct string value, which must be immutable. Interning strings makes some string processing tasks more time- or space-efficient at the cost of requiring more time when the string is created or interned. The distinct values are stored in a string intern pool. The single copy of each string is called its intern and is typically looked up by a method of the st… WebI have recently written an article about String.intern() implementation in Java 6, 7 and 8: String.intern in Java 6, 7 and 8 - string pooling. I hope it should contain enough … last losses russians
String interning - HandWiki
WebFeb 11, 2015 · Otherwise, the method adds the string to the pool and returns the reference to it. If you want to just check if a string is already interned, you should use the … WebEverything about Strings in detail including how a string is interned and when it is not interned. Heap vs String pool, manually interning a string, + operat... WebShared interned strings buffer. Cached scripts HashTable. Global OPcache shared memory state. ... and not leave one single pointer allocated onto this pool, but copy it into a shared memory allocated pool. And here we talk about compile-time, whatever has been allocated by the compiler, ... last man on moon movie